Hi all. I hope I've posted this in the right section, apologies if I haven't.
I'm trying to get around 70 photos developed in a 6'x4' size and I was wondering if any of you knew of somewhere that is reasonably priced to get it done. Boots want 35p a photo which seems a bit steep to me.I'd ideally like a couple of the photos blown up onto canvas or larger sizes too.
So if anyone knows of a place on the high street or online which do it at a good price then it would be really appreciated.
Josh

I have been doing photogrpahy since I was 13 and over that time used loads of places.
The best place by far is truprint, they are uk based online photo developing company.
You can select how many of each photo you require, sizes ranging from 6x4 to poster sized. You can also choose to have them bordered and between matt or gloss finish
Its also the cheapest place I have found plus they mail the photos back to you very very quickly, no fuss no nonsense.

I've used http://www.photobox.co.uk a lot, and never had any problems. Current prices are 11p each for a 6x4, plus £1.49 postage (same day dispatch as well). They also do a wide range of enlargements, canvas printing, etc.
You can also get quidco cashback for them.0 -
